Output 9840e19307cf3161cd2d48b1e28e92261b99b246081ef9e7ce5d61363b4c0630:1

value
43901051
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23b4f0fdeadb9a75d4ba4291d4d2162b7b8e79f8 OP_EQUAL
address
34wpLHUiprtv4U2wyrVAPR46zPsVMzWacv
transaction
9840e19307cf3161cd2d48b1e28e92261b99b246081ef9e7ce5d61363b4c0630